Duration: contract to run until 31/12/2025
Location: London, hybrid working
Rate: up to £276 p/d Umbrella inside IR35
Role purpose / summary
You will ensure that all activities and duties are carried out in full compliance with regulatory requirements, Enterprise Wide Risk Management Framework and internal Policies and Policy Standards.
You will develop components from UI to back end using modern languages and techniques.
You will create and maintain deployment tooling and automation to support the CI/CD pipelines.
You will identify own and others development needs and seek opportunities to address these needs through guidance, coaching and formal training.
Key Skills/ requirements
What we’re looking for:
- Good hands on Java/J2EE and Springboot experience
- Experience working with RESTful
- Some experience with JavaScript
- Exposure to Cloud Tools
- Good understanding of Object Oriented Concepts and Design Patterns
Skills that will help you in the role:
- You have experience of working within Financial Services industry.
- You have experience creating prototypes and working directly with stakeholders.
- You have experience with Event based architectures.
- Strong knowledge of Unix, Shell Scripting, Docker or other containers
- AWS or other cloud platform experience
- Knowledge of Maven, GIT, TeamCity, Nexus, SonarCube, IntelliJ Idea
- Proven analytical skills and logical thinking to manage issues in a high-pressure environment
